1. Define Your Niche and Brand Identity: Before you even think about posting, you need a clear understanding of who you are and what you offer. What unique skills or knowledge do you possess? What problems can you solve for your audience? Your niche should be specific enough to attract a dedicated following but broad enough to allow for growth. Once you've identified your niche, develop a consistent brand identity. This includes your visual aesthetic (logo, color scheme, fonts), your tone of voice (formal, informal, humorous), and the overall message you want to convey.

2. Choose the Right Platforms: Not all platforms are created equal. Consider your target audience and the type of content you want to create when selecting your social media channels. Are you targeting a younger demographic? TikTok and Instagram might be your best bet. For a more professional audience, LinkedIn might be more effective. Don't spread yourself too thin; focus on a few platforms where you can consistently create high-quality content.

3. Content is King (and Queen!): High-quality content is the bedrock of any successful social media strategy. What kind of content resonates with your audience? Experiment with different formats – videos, images, infographics, blog posts, live streams – to see what performs best. Remember, consistency is key. Establish a posting schedule and stick to it as much as possible. This helps keep your audience engaged and keeps your profile active in their feeds.

4. Know Your Audience: Understanding your target audience is crucial. Who are they? What are their interests? What are their pain points? Use analytics tools provided by each platform to track your audience demographics and engagement metrics. This data will help you tailor your content to their needs and preferences, leading to higher engagement and follower growth.

5. Engage with Your Audience: Social media is a two-way street. Don't just broadcast your content; actively engage with your audience. Respond to comments and messages promptly, participate in relevant conversations, and ask questions to encourage interaction. Building a genuine connection with your followers is essential for fostering loyalty and growth.

6. Leverage Hashtags Strategically: Hashtags are crucial for expanding your reach. Research relevant hashtags that are both popular and specific to your niche. Don't overdo it; a few well-chosen hashtags are more effective than a long list of irrelevant ones. Mix popular hashtags with more niche-specific ones to reach a broader audience while targeting your ideal followers.

7. Collaborate with Others: Collaborating with other influencers or businesses in your niche can significantly boost your reach and exposure. Consider guest posting on other blogs, participating in joint ventures, or cross-promoting each other's content. This can introduce you to a new audience and build valuable relationships.

8. Run Contests and Giveaways: Contests and giveaways are a great way to increase engagement and attract new followers. Offer a prize that is relevant to your niche and clearly define the rules of participation. Promote your contest across your social media channels and encourage sharing to maximize reach.

9. Utilize Paid Advertising (When Appropriate): While organic growth is important, paid advertising can accelerate your progress. Platforms like Facebook, Instagram, and LinkedIn offer targeted advertising options that allow you to reach specific demographics and interests. Start small, experiment with different ad formats, and track your results carefully to optimize your spending.

10. Analyze and Adapt: Regularly analyze your social media performance using built-in analytics tools. Track key metrics such as follower growth, engagement rate, reach, and website traffic. Use this data to identify what's working and what's not, and adjust your strategy accordingly. Social media is a dynamic landscape; continuous adaptation is key to success.

11. Stay Consistent and Patient: Building a successful personal brand takes time and effort. Don't get discouraged if you don't see results overnight. Stay consistent with your posting schedule, engage with your audience, and continue to learn and adapt. The more effort you put in, the greater your rewards will be.

12. Provide Value: Focus on providing genuine value to your audience. Share insightful content, offer helpful advice, and create a community where people feel supported and engaged. People follow accounts that offer something of value, whether it's entertainment, education, or inspiration.

13. Use High-Quality Visuals: In the world of social media, visuals are king. Invest in high-quality images and videos that are visually appealing and consistent with your brand identity. Use editing tools to enhance your visuals and make them stand out.

14. Stay Updated with Trends: Social media is constantly evolving. Stay updated with the latest trends, algorithm changes, and best practices to ensure your strategy remains effective. Follow industry leaders and participate in relevant online communities to stay ahead of the curve.

15. Don't Be Afraid to Experiment: Don't be afraid to try new things and experiment with different approaches. What works for one person might not work for another. The key is to find what resonates with your audience and stick with it.
